Hoping someone with more familiarity of the current GW range can assist...
I'm wondering if there are good alternatives to the Leagues of Votann tanks as I'm not a big fan of their styling. I remember back in 2nd edition Squats were aligned with the Imperium and a lot of their tanks seemed to be incorporated into the few armies I saw.
Please help me in identifying which vehicles might be suitable alternatives to the Sagitaur and Hekaton Land Fortress. I'm digging the 30k tanks that are being released, if any of those have similar equipment, that would be awesome. Are there any that would require minimal conversion and/or already include appropriate armaments?

The Mantic ForgeFather tanks are the correct size. Only a few millimeters wider, and the correct height. I'm using them with a cupula mounted twin-heavy bolter and Cyclone missle launcher sourced from the Raven Wing upgrade sprue.
